BasicVSR++ function for VapourSynth

Overview

BasicVSR++

BasicVSR++: Improving Video Super-Resolution with Enhanced Propagation and Alignment

Ported from https://github.com/open-mmlab/mmediting

Dependencies

Installing mmcv-full on Windows is a bit complicated as it requires Visual Studio and other tools to compile CUDA ops. So I have uploaded the built file compiled with CUDA 11.1 for Windows users and you can install it by executing the following command.

pip install https://github.com/HolyWu/vs-basicvsrpp/releases/download/v1.0.0/mmcv_full-1.3.12-cp39-cp39-win_amd64.whl

Installation

pip install --upgrade vsbasicvsrpp
python -m vsbasicvsrpp

Usage

from vsbasicvsrpp import BasicVSRPP

ret = BasicVSRPP(clip)

See __init__.py for the description of the parameters.

  • Question regarding some Arguments

    Question regarding some Arguments

    Hi, My appologies, I'm not sure if I forgot to submit my last typed issue or if it was removed. If it was removed, feel free to close this without a comment. I typed it this morning, and honestly, can't remember if I submitted or closed the browser window by accident.

    I have a few questions for some of the arguments one can set, as those are a bit different from the mmediting interface, if I have seen that correctly.

    Interval: This specifies the number of Images per Batch, is that correct? In addition of reducing the VRam footprint, I assume it influences what the network can see during the upscale process? The smaller the batch, the smaller the window it can include in the temporal calculations?

    Tiling: This splits the image into tiles for processing instead of the whole image, is that correct? What is the purpose or best case scenario someone would use this for?

    FP16: I run the network with FP16 at the moment, as FP32 usually blows up my 11GB of VRam if I don't reduce the Interval. As I had not enough time to finish all my Tests yesterday, have you noticed any degradation in quality in Images when FP16 is used? If I want to run it with FP32, I need to reduce the Interval but if my assumption is correct, this narrows down the time-window the network can calculate across. So I'm in between Precision vs Intervall-Size for VRam usage. Do you have any experience in this and what a good tradeoff might look like.
